Market Overview

With surging demand for electricity from renewable power, sources led to year-over-year (YoY) growth of 53% in the global wind industry. Amidst the Covid19 pandemic installation of more than 93 GW of wind power was a challenging job with disruption to both the global supply chain and project construction has demonstrated the incredible resilience of the wind industry. Additionally, the 93 GW of new installations in FY 2020-21 brought global cumulative wind power capacity up to 743 GW.

In terms of cumulative installations, the top five markets as of the end of 2020 were China, U.S., Germany, India, and Spain, which together accounted for 73% of the world's total wind power installations. China and U.S. remained the world's largest markets for new onshore additions, and the world's two major economies together increased their market share by 15% to 76%.

COVID-19 Impact

Travel bans, supply chain pressure, and deferred maintenance of wind energy are among the key challenges faced by wind farm owners during the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ic. The lack of manpower to fix the breakdown of wind farms is another challenge that companies in the wind energy market need to tackle. Moreover, factory shutdowns worldwide have affected the uptake of renewable energy. This led to difficulties in adhering to deadlines for building new projects.

However, as per IEA, the impact of Covid-19 on offshore deployment in 2020 and 2021 remains limited as offshore projects have longer construction periods than do onshore projects. Most projects in their period for 2020 and 2021 are either partially commissioned or at an advanced stage of development.

More than 80% of total wind turbine mass is made up of recyclable materials, such as steel, iron, copper, and aluminum, according to National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L). But anywhere from 11-16% is composed of carbon fiber or fiberglass composites, plastics, and resin, primarily for rotor blades which have a life expectancy of up to 25 years and are currently difficult to recycle commercially.

The onshore wind became one of the cheapest new sources of electricity in 2020, while offshore wind has delivered an incredible global levelized cost of electricity (LCOE) reduction of more than 67% over the last 8 years. Costs will decline by another third by 2030. In 2020, 86.9 GW of onshore & 6 GW of offshore wind capacity was added globally, wind capacity beyond the 700 GW milestone.
